The NI PXIe-2727 9-Channel 16-bit Programmable Resistor, with part number 781986-27, falls under the category of PXI Switches. This model, PXIe-2727, is designed to deliver precise and flexible solutions for hardware simulation and testing applications.
It features 9 channels with a 16-bit resolution, allowing for detailed and accurate adjustments. The maximum resistance output that can be achieved is 16 kiloohms, with the minimum step size being a fine 0.25 ohms. This granularity enables users to simulate a wide range of resistance values with high precision.
Channel accuracy varies depending on the resistance range, ensuring reliable performance across different settings:
- Less than 10.0% for 20 Ω to 40 Ω
- Less than 5.0% for 40 Ω to 120 Ω and 20 Ω to 64 Ω
- Less than 2.0% for 120 Ω to 400 Ω and 64 Ω to 255 Ω
- Less than 1.0% for 400 Ω to 16,000 Ω
Each channel of the PXIe-2727 can handle a maximum current of 0.3 A and a maximum power of 0.25 W, ensuring that the module can handle a variety of testing scenarios without compromising on performance. Furthermore, the system has a simultaneous drive limit of 161 relays, highlighting its capacity for extensive and complex testing setups.
